For Full Coverage
Re-locate the 800-H Transmitter at least once several steps to
the right or left in order to provide complete coverage. This is
because any conductor which is directly underneath the Trans-
mitter will not be detected.
Pinpoint and Determine Signal Source
As with normal Inductive Locating, place the 800-H Transmitter
upright on one of the marks made earlier, (in line with the sus-
pected run of the conductor). Pinpoint the conductor on the
other side of the search area in the normal manner, as described
on page 11.
After pinpointing the conductor, raise the receiver toward the
Transmitter to be sure the signal is mostly coming from the con-
ductor and not through the air, as described on page 13.
Repeat this process for each of the HIGH pitch areas found ear-
lier and mark the lines accordingly.
SEARCH AND SWEEP

Two Person

Generally, two people can perform a search over a broad area
quicker than one person.
Set Up the Search
Start over an area where there are no conductors. One person
holds the Transmitter to his/her side in line with the suspected
run of the conductor(s). The other person stands approximately
30 feet away from the Transmitter, holding the Receiver to his/
her side. (Be sure the receiver is set to receive High-frequency,
page 8.) Turn both units ON, and keep them pointed at each
other. Set the Receiver's sensitivity control so that the meter
reads 4 and you hear a LOW pitched tone. The tone will get
higher as you get closer to conductors.
